Quarterly Planning Note — Headcount, Next Year

Department heads: the draft headcount plan allows net growth of six roles company-wide at Quillbrook Systems. Engineering receives three, operations two, and client services one. Backfills require director sign-off and must stay within approved band levels. Submit final requests before the November planning session in Darvale. Contractor conversions count against these totals. Please read the confidential note below before circulating any figures.

internal memo for fajog-yagaf: Gross margin on Ulaael came in at 20 percent against a plan of 10 percent. Only 9 of the 80 pilot accounts renewed Ulaael, so a churn review is set for July 1.

Handover – leased laptops

Mara,

Twelve Orbix laptops wiped and boxed, ready for return to Lendware Leasing. Asset tags checked against the return sheet; two chargers missing, noted on the form. Boxes are stacked by the dispatch counter, taped and labelled. Pick-up is booked with Swiftrow Couriers for Thursday. Don't release anything without the return sheet signed. Courier hand-over instruction is below.

handover note for yagef-bagep: the drudor pelius courier leaves the kasdor zorvan norir ledger at gate 8016 under passcode 755406

Finance Review Summary — Calloway Fabrication

Quick read for the incoming director: the Denmoor plant is running at roughly 68% capacity, and the numbers say we either add a second shift or consolidate lines into the Ashgate site. Payback on the shift option is about fourteen months; consolidation is cheaper but riskier on lead times. We've leaned toward the shift. Full reasoning sits in the note below.

confidential, kagep-kahof: Druokax Systems plans to lower the Ulaath list price by 53 percent in March.

Handover — Marit to Doron

Quick one before I'm off: the joint venture proposal with Kelvane Foods is nearly signed off. Sales leads should keep pitching the Orrisdale range as standalone until the ink dries. Doron will own the negotiation from Monday — loop him in on anything Kelvane-related. One more thing before you brief the team, and keep this close.

management briefing: The renewal with Quenathox Group closes at $10 million a year, 20 percent below the last contract. Project Ulawyn slips by two quarters because of the supplier delay.